Higher education is at a critical juncture. Declining enrollment among traditional student populations necessitates a shift in approach towards the New Majority Learner, a group who often experience barriers to learning such as:
- Time poverty: Juggling work, family, and academic commitments, leading to overwhelming schedules and difficulty finding time to study.
- Financial strain: Facing challenges affording tuition, fees, and living expenses while managing existing financial obligations.
- Lack of support: Navigating higher education with limited guidance and support systems, potentially impacting academic performance and persistence.
